A girl stands on the roof of 55m tall building and throws a baseball

at an angle of 30° above horizontal at an angle of 10m/s.
a. How long the ball is in air.

Answer:

3.9 seconds

Step-by-step explanation:

Given:

y₀ = 55 m

y = 0 m

v₀ = 10 sin 30° m/s = 5 m/s

a = -9.8 m/s²

Find: t

y = y₀ + v₀ t + ½ at²

0 m = 55 m + (5 m/s) t + ½ (-9.8 m/s²) t²

0 = 55 + 5t − 4.9t²

4.9t² − 5t − 55 = 0

Solve with quadratic formula:

t = [ -(-5) ± √((-5)² − 4(4.9)(-55)) ] / 2(4.9)

t = (5 ± √1103) / 9.8

t = 3.9
